Output 3d65aa719512410e2936a5d36b00b80b989f89395935aff7a32357212a07b967:0

value
27063130
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b158d0ab9713889f5cb5364569049a339c1a1b19 OP_EQUALVERIFY OP_CHECKSIG
address
1HAizwKg4939DY4sixwaRrHaxTDzt1h7m8
transaction
3d65aa719512410e2936a5d36b00b80b989f89395935aff7a32357212a07b967
spent
true